Pros

The environment was filled with friendly associates, coordinators and management. I found that management was easy to approach and that they were very flexible with workers. I really enjoyed my department, crew, and co-coordinator.

Cons

There was never enough staffing. My store is a high-volume store so without proper staffing, it is impossible to maintain an empty backroom and made unloading truck and unpacking and organizing freight hectic and at times overwhelming. I feel that the amount of work I and my team did was worth more than the amount that we were being paid. The starting pay at our store for associates is $12 and the starting pay for coordinators is $12.50 as of 2023. It is also difficult to move up within the company. People who should have been rewarded with management positions were often overlooked even though they had more experience and worked for the company for nearly a decade. This was very difficult for moral.
